Praises and brickbats: Bihar CM's 'Ask Nitish' hashtag gets reactions on Twitter

In an attempt to reach out to the urban, tech-savvy sections of the electorate,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ar started the “Ask Nitish” hashtag on Twitter. One Twitter user wrote that he was “impressed” with the work done by him to improve Bihar, but asked “What about Lalu Yadav and jungle raj?” Another user said that Nitish should take “sue” the prime minister’s office for lying to Bihar and misusing official position for political gains.

On the other hand, one person questioned why he has made requests to the centre for aid if he had so many achievements to his credit. Another user questioned whether by joining hands with RJD chief Lalu Prasad Yadav, Nitish has made an alliance with a corrupt entity.
